House of Friendship is a charitable social service agency serving thousands, providing addiction treatment, food, housing, and community resources throughout Waterloo Region.

The Quality team stewards the data, evaluation, processes and frameworks that support House of Friendship’s team members, leaders, and Board of Directors to manage privacy and risk, ensure program reporting compliance, maintain accreditation, and improve the quality of our services.

The Manager of Program Data & Health Information leads the program data strategy and is responsible for the organization’s participant record and case management systems (primarily EMHware), ensuring they effectively support service delivery, reporting, privacy, and quality improvement. This role provides leadership to the Data team, overseeing the development of robust data systems, processes, and reporting tools that support organizational priorities and enable evidence-informed decision‑making. The Manager will champion data literacy and foster a culture of continuous improvement by guiding teams in effective data use, reporting, and evaluation. They will serve as the primary liaison for internal and external interest‑holders on program data governance, electronic health record system management, and data insights generation.

  • This is a permanent, salaried, full‑time (37.5 hours per week) position with paid sick time, personal days, vacation time; group health benefits and defined contribution pension plan.

Schedule is Monday to Friday, generally daytime hours, with flexibility. Work may be performed from a home office for some of the weekly hours.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ide leadership and oversight for the Data Analyst and Data Coordinator, including coaching, performance management, and professional development
  • Responsible for ensuring a physically and psychologically healthy work environment for all team members
  • Develop and implement the organization’s program data strategy, ensuring alignment with strategic priorities, funder requirements, and regulatory compliance
  • Manage the design, implementation and continuous improvement of participant record and case management systems (primarily EMHware), ensuring they effectively support service delivery, reporting, quality improvement, and privacy (PHIPA) and information security requirements
  • Support the Advanced Clinical Practice Lead to establish and maintain practices, policies and procedures on client documentation standards and case management within EMHware
  • Lead the Data team in the development of organizational program reporting processes and dashboards for Board, leadership, funders, grantors and regulators
  • Champion organizational and departmental change initiatives, as needed; helping leaders, team members and people we support to understand the change and engaging them in the process
  • Drive initiatives to improve data quality, integrity, and accessibility across all programs
  • Collaborate with program leaders to identify data needs, support service integration, and translate data into actionable insights for decision‑making, program evaluation and quality improvement and team engagement
  • Champion data literacy and evidence‑informed practices by developing and delivering training, resources, and knowledge products for staff and leadership
  • Manage relationships with external database vendors and system administrators, negotiating service agreements and ensuring system reliability
  • Monitor emerging trends and best practices in data management and analytics to inform organizational improvements
  • Contribute to strategic planning and organizational projects as a member of the Quality leadership team, and the organizational management team
  • Job Specific Knowledge / Skills

  • Demonstrated proficiency and expertise in data governance, privacy legislation (PHIPA), and risk management in a social services or healthcare context
  • Strong leadership and team management skills, with experience supervising data‑focused roles
  • Expert knowledge in the management and administration of health information systems and electronic health records (EHRs); familiarity with EMHware is a strong asset
  • Proven ability to design and implement organizational reporting frameworks and dashboards for diverse interest‑holders
  • Demonstrated ability to apply project management and change management practices to drive the successful implementation of departmental and organizational initiatives
  • Advanced analytical and critical thinking skills, with experience in translating complex data into actionable insights
  • Proficient understanding of data visualization tools (e.g., Power BI) and advanced Excel functionality, as needed to effectively supervise staff who execute using these tools
  • Excellent interpersonal, verbal, and written communication skills, including the ability to present data to non‑technical audiences
  • Strong organizational and project management sk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ities
  • Education / Experience

  • University degree in a related field (e.g., Health Informatics, Public Health, Statistics, Computer Science, Data Science)
  • Minimum 5 years of experience in data management, analytics, or decision support, with at least 2 years in a leadership or supervisory role
  • Experience in healthcare or social services environments strongly preferred
  • Demonstrated competency in qualitative and quantitative data analytics, visualization, and reporting
